Neural correlates of religious experience.

N P Azari1, J Nickel, G Wunderlich

  • 1Department of Neurology, University Hospital Düsseldorf, Germany. nazari@du.edu

The European Journal of Neuroscience
|May 1, 2001
PubMed
Summary

Religious experiences, often felt as immediate, involve cognitive processes. Neuroimaging shows activation in frontal-parietal brain regions during religious recitation, suggesting a link between thought evaluation and spiritual feelings.

Background:

  • Commonsense views often describe religious experience as immediate and preconceptual.
  • Philosophical and psychological research suggests religious experiences are cognitive attributional phenomena.
  • Understanding the neural basis of religious experience is crucial for bridging these perspectives.

Purpose of the Study:

  • To investigate the neural correlates of religious experience using functional neuroimaging.
  • To explore the cognitive processes underlying religious experiences.
  • To examine if religious experiences, despite feeling immediate, are rooted in cognitive functions.

Main Methods:

  • Functional neuroimaging (fMRI) was employed to observe brain activity.

  • Participants included self-identified religious individuals.
  • Brain activity was measured during a religious recitation task.
  • Main Results:

    • Activation was observed in a specific frontal-parietal circuit during religious recitation.
    • This circuit included the dorsolateral prefrontal cortex, dorsomedial frontal cortex, and medial parietal cortex.
    • These activated areas are known to be involved in reflexive evaluation of thought.

    Conclusions:

    • Religious experience may be a cognitive process rather than purely affective or preconceptual.
    • The feeling of immediacy in religious experience could stem from the rapid, reflexive cognitive evaluation occurring in specific brain networks.
    • Neuroimaging provides insights into the cognitive underpinnings of subjective religious experiences.
